Output 0d34d52081d226e4f12c9a86a8edc62aad0e212b60b98a717e62a9699004e06e:1

value
25615744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9e763336efae99dc5ca31b2835e594099c5304 OP_EQUAL
address
3HX2eqtMyEvGfM7UqjMNrVDeri47iJF4X2
transaction
0d34d52081d226e4f12c9a86a8edc62aad0e212b60b98a717e62a9699004e06e
spent
true